Where the stock actually goes
In an aesthetic clinic the expensive items are consumed inside a procedure rather than handed to a patient, so they never pass through a dispensing screen and never leave a trace. The result is a stock figure that is confidently wrong and a margin nobody can explain.

What Klinira does not do
Stated here rather than discovered after you have paid.
- There is no before-and-after photo comparison tool in version 1. Photos can be attached to a record; they are not laid out side by side for you.
